1. We knew this team was going to have some offensive woes, but 45 points, that's bad. To shoot 26% from the field and set a new low point total for the Puerto Rico tournament is never a good thing.
2. I don't care if he's double or triple teamed, in 3 games this year Jarnell has not looked like a guy who's leaving early for the NBA draft, and that continued today. 7pts 4rbd in 28 minutes against Jurick won't impress any NBA scout.
3. You can say the 10:30 start time bothered them all you want, bottom line is Oklahoma had to start the exact same time as we did and they had no issues bringing the intensity.
4. This team HAS got to learn how to play without fouling, it has been an issue in all 3 games and against better teams like Okie State you can't do that and expect to win. They scored 23 points from the free throw line and were in the bonus 5 minutes into the second half, hard to come back when the other teams in the bonus.
5. Our ugly perimeter shooting from last year reappeared today...5/23 22%, not good numbers at all.
6. We once again get outrebounded, and this time by double digits. Rebounding was supposed to be a strength of this team and right now it's not...I'll repeat from above, Jarnell has got to be better rebounding, 4 is pathetic.
7. Our turnovers weren't horrible, only 11, but with only 5 assists it's obvious the ball just wasn't moving like it should. Trae has 2 assists and 1 turnover, we need much better production from him in terms of assists.
8. I thought defensively we were decent, when we weren't fouling. Hell we held them to 62 points, and 23 of those came from the foul line, not too shabby.
9. It appears CCM has lost some faith in Armani. After a travel call in which Armani made a nice move to the basket, CCM pulled him and I don't believe Moore saw action again. We went with McRae at the point and that's not something anyone hoped to see.
10. Speaking of McRae, if I'm giving a player of the game I give it to him. Thought he was one of the only guys to take it to the rim with intent to score in the second half, would like to see him keep that mindset going forward.
**extra** we need Maymon back, this game made it glaringly obvious. A lot of the issues I mention above, he helps with, especially the rebounding and consistent scoring. These lulls of 5 minutes without a basket, that's where we really miss him. Without Jeronne this team is going to have trouble scoring some nights and is probably a borderline NCAA team that doesn't have the fire power to make a run...with Maymon a think they're a solid seed with a chance of making a run.
